Processing.org - 0 views

  •  
    Processing is an open source programming language and environment for people who want to create images, animations, and interactions. Initially developed to serve as a software sketchbook and to teach fundamentals of computer programming within a visual context, Processing also has evolved into a tool for generating finished professional work. Today, there are tens of thousands of students, artists, designers, researchers, and hobbyists who use Processing for learning, prototyping, and production. * » Free to download and open source * » Interactive programs using 2D, 3D or PDF output * » OpenGL integration for accelerated 3D * » For GNU/Linux, Mac OS X, and Windows * » Projects run online or as double-clickable applications * » Over 100 libraries extend the software into sound, video, computer vision, and more... * » Well documented, with many books available

ardour | the new digital audio workstation - 0 views

  •  
    Ardour is a digital audio workstation. You can use it to record, edit and mix multi-track audio. You can produce your own CDs, mix video soundtracks, or just experiment with new ideas about music and sound.

PURE DATA: 23 Open Sound Control, Part 1 - YouTube - 0 views

  •  
    This video is a great demonstration of the OSC protocol using the Pure Data software and the Osculator software on Macintosh. Shows an example of how to make a Wiimote and WiiDJ controller function with a mac and how to use those devices to control Pure Data. This tutorial is relatively technical, but gives a good introduction of what the OSC protocol is capable of.

ruipenha. » GameLan - 0 views

  •  
    "An evolution of an old software called «Digital Jam», GameLan is a software made for networked improvisation based on Gamelan music. Upon launching the application, it searches for any users currently improvising and automatically joins them. It can also be used individually, but only if there aren't any other improvisers on the same network! Each user controls the sequencing of several Gamelan instruments and a soloist located in the middle circle. This software can also be used to control the Robotic Gamelan. The above video captures an early stage of development."

Make stories - storify.com - 0 views

  •  
    Storify is a way to tell stories using social media such as Tweets, photos and videos. You search multiple social networks from one place, and then drag individual elements into your story. You can re-order the elements and also add text to give context to your readers.
